Skip to content

Commit 1005e0d

Browse files
committed
re-xfail
1 parent 221328d commit 1005e0d

File tree

1 file changed

+4
-2
lines changed

1 file changed

+4
-2
lines changed

pandas/tests/io/parser/test_na_values.py

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-671,10 +671,12 @@ def test_inf_na_values_with_int_index(all_parsers):
671671

672672

673673
@pytest.mark.parametrize("na_filter", [True, False])
674-
def test_na_values_with_dtype_str_and_na_filter(all_parsers, na_filter, request):
674+
def test_na_values_with_dtype_str_and_na_filter(
675+
all_parsers, na_filter, using_infer_string, request
676+
):
675677
# see gh-20377
676678
parser = all_parsers
677-
if parser.engine == "pyarrow" and na_filter is False:
679+
if parser.engine == "pyarrow" and (na_filter is False or not using_infer_string):
678680
mark = pytest.mark.xfail(reason="mismatched shape")
679681
request.applymarker(mark)
680682

0 commit comments

Comments
 (0)